Entertaining Family and Guests<br />

A key part to your event, is keeping all your<br />

family, friends and guests entertained. No<br />

matter how young or old <strong>the</strong>y may be, a little<br />

entertainment throughout <strong>the</strong> day will be fun<br />

for everyone.<br />

• <strong>Easter</strong> Egg Hunt - Hide <strong>Easter</strong> eggs or<br />

fun <strong>Easter</strong> goodies in random places<br />

around <strong>the</strong> house and garden whilst<br />

providing small clues to guide your<br />

guests, and hand <strong>the</strong>m baskets to<br />

collect all <strong>the</strong>ir treats!<br />

• Egg Painting - Get one or two hard<br />

boiled eggs for each guest (and<br />

yourself) and let all your creative skills<br />

go wild.<br />

• Egg Rolling - Once everyone has<br />

painted <strong>the</strong>ir eggs, <strong>the</strong> traditional egg<br />

rolling contest can take place, where<br />

everyone rolls <strong>the</strong>ir egg down a hill<br />

and <strong>the</strong> first one that reaches <strong>the</strong><br />

finish line (without breaking) is <strong>the</strong><br />

winner!<br />

• <strong>Easter</strong> Crafts - From decorating<br />

bonnets to making rabbit masks with<br />

paper plates, <strong>the</strong>re are many different<br />

crafts for <strong>the</strong> adults and children to<br />

get involved with.<br />
